I have a 2016 v6s and my exhaust valves suffered the usual failure. Had it checked by the independent whilst it was in for other work and they confirmed the issue as irreparable.
I did some googling and came across mod_stock on the forum but didn't find any specific review.
There are a few options to choose from, prices are as of 03-02-24 so may change:
1) Exchange the box via post. They offer an exchange service where they send you down a repaired box where they have cut out the failed valves and replaced them with uprated valves with stronger springs that come with an ownership warranty (as long as you own the vehilce) the cost for this was £360 plus postage both ways plus a £350 refundable deposit given back when your old unit is returned.
2) They will come and replace it in person. This is the option I chose as by the time I paid for postage and the local independent to replace it, it was more expensive to have the exchange unit. They drove down and replaced it for me for the price of £420 (360 + 60 fitting). They put the car up on ramps and it took roughly 30 mins.
3) you can purchase the valves from their website and have a local exhaust company do the work for you. They are £120 each and then it's down to how much your local repair shop charges for the repair. I'm not sure about warranty with this repair.
4) The mod. This is the same as the first two services but they cut the oem box open and make the loud side louder. I love the idea but I already worry about waking the neighbours with my morning bark so I opted against it. The cost for this is £720 plus postage or plus the fitting fee.
